Which One Is Right for You?
Chocolope and Gushers are both excellent strains with distinct characteristics. Chocolope is a Sativa with 19–25% THC, while Gushers is a Hybrid with 15–22% THC. Your choice depends on your preference for effects, growing difficulty, and intended use.
Choose Chocolope
Choose Chocolope if you want higher THC potency, easier growing. Chocolope, also known as "D-Line," is a popular sativa marijuana strain made by crossing Chocolate Thai with Cannalope Haze.
